在昨天文章的末尾,有读者提到了这样一个问题:
如果真正的链游,是开放、无许可的,任何人凭借一个钱包就可以登录游玩,那么如何解决女巫攻击问题?
这个问题如果更加泛化一些可以概括成:
如果我们要让区块链这个所谓的“价值互联网”保持无许可、任何人都可以访问,那么如何解决女巫攻击问题?
这其实是我长久以来都在思考的问题。正巧前一段时间我和朋友交流的时候也谈及了这个问题。
我觉得这个问题的答案恐怕我们的先辈已经给出来了,它就在中本聪的白皮书里面:用贡献算力的办法解决女巫攻击问题。
当然,这个“算力”放在这个泛化的问题中可以理解为消耗资源,而并不一定专指用计算机去进行POW挖矿。
我们都知道一个很朴素的道理:这个世界上没有十全十美的方案,任何方案当它追求一个目标时必然被迫放弃其它的目标,或者为了现实不得不在多个目标之间进行妥协。
区块链技术自打落地起(比特币创世区块诞生)的那一刻就饱含了密码朋克运动的历代前辈们为之倾注的心血和期望:那就是建立一个隐私、平权的世界。
这里所谓的“平权”就是指任何人都可以参与并且在参与时不需要任何中心化机构的批准及审核。
这种理想在我看来隐含了这样一个追求:这个网络对所有人,无论好人还是坏人,都是公平的。也就是说它认为坏人也不能被剥夺参与的权利。
那么在这种状况下,如何防止坏人作恶呢?中本聪给出了最直接的答案:那就是参与者要贡献算力,让作恶者即便想作恶也要付出代价。也就是说这个网络并不禁止作恶,而是让作恶有代价,并通过这个代价防止作恶影响网络的正常工作。
我认为这是加密生态的一个核心基因。
结合这个理念再来看游戏场景,我认为解决女巫攻击的办法就是用户必须付出资源:游戏要有一套机制,让用户必须消耗脑力、付出资源才能得到游戏的奖励、代币等。当然,用户如果只是随意逛逛,那只需要付区块链的基本交易费就可以。
有些玩家可能担心这样的游戏会不会在早期不利于用户普及,我觉得那是因为这样的链游目前还没有在我们的现实世界中出现,所以我们无法确信已经习惯了免费游玩的大众有多少会愿意付费去玩一个陌生的游戏。
但我相信理想中的“链上世界”会具备无限的想象力,给用户无限的创造空间。那时,我们会把那个世界当成我们的第二个家园,我们每个人会想方设法在那个家园重新创造我们的身份、人设和地位。它足以吸引我们付费加入,同时因为这个付费能将蓄意作恶控制在一定的范围内。
实际上我甚至认为在很多其它的区块链应用中也可以使用类似的方法阻遏作恶,过滤“女巫”---比如我理想中的加密社交应用。
我们可以想象一下,如果我们在社交媒体中发文章、留言都需要付费,那是不是当下很多无意义的文章、言论都会被自觉过滤掉?
区块链应用自诞生以来(比如比特币),它的基因就包含了加密资产,它就是一个内置资产的价值网络。此外这个价值网络还是无需许可的。这些因素在我看来都决定了这个网络应该有一定的门槛。
所以我并不认为传统互联网免费使用的模式真的就适合加密世界。
让用户付费、付出一定代价既是价值网络内在的需求,也是防范女巫攻击最好的办法。
来源:金色财经